Twin River hasn't had much luck against David City recently, but that could start to change on Friday. The Twin River Titans are taking a road trip to square off against the David City Scouts at 7:00 p.m. Expect the scorekeeper to be kept busy: if their previous games are any indication, both will really light up the scoreboard.
Twin River lost 60-34 to Clarkson/Leigh on Friday.
Twin River might have lost, but man, Paydon Rinkol was a machine: he rushed for 183 yards and two touchdowns while picking up 7.6 yards per carry, and also threw for 71 yards and a touchdown. Rinkol showed off some serious burst, turning on the afterburners on one carry for 58 yards. Eli Slizoski was another key back, gaining 115 total yards and a touchdown.
Meanwhile, David City put another one in the bag on Friday to keep their perfect season alive. They blew past Newman Grove/St. Edward, posting a 50-6 win on the road. With the Scouts ahead 44-0 at the half, the game was all but over already.
David City's victory was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Reese Svoboda, who rushed for 82 yards and a touchdown on only five carries. Cohen Denker was in the mix too, providing David City with two touchdowns.
Twin River's defeat dropped their record down to 2-2. As for David City, their win bumped their record up to 4-0.
Twin River ended up a good deal behind David City when the teams last played back in August of 2021, losing 22-6. Can Twin River av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
